#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
%YAML 1.2
---
$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/watchdog/mediatek,mt7621-wdt.yaml#
$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#

title: Ralink Watchdog Timers

maintainers:
  - Sergio Paracuellos <sergio.paracuellos@gmail.com>

allOf:
  - $ref: watchdog.yaml#

properties:
  compatible:
    const: mediatek,mt7621-wdt

  reg:
    maxItems: 1

  mediatek,sysctl:
    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/phandle
    description:
      phandle to system controller 'sysc' syscon node which
      controls system registers

required:
  - compatible
  - reg

additionalProperties: false

examples:
  - |
    watchdog@100 {
        compatible = "mediatek,mt7621-wdt";
        reg = <0x100 0x100>;
        mediatek,sysctl = <&sysc>;
    };
